In field of defence, we have agreed on five-year roadmap: PM Modi

India and Tanzania are important partners for mutual trade, investment: PM Modi after talks with Tanzanian President

Prime Minister Narendra Modi said, “Today is a historic day in the relations between India and Tanzania. Today we are tying our age-old friendship into a Strategic Partnership. India and Tanzania are important partners for mutual trade and investment. Both sides are working on an agreement to increase trade in local currencies. India has made significant contributions to Tanzania’s skill development and capacity building through ICT centres, vocational training, defence training, ITEC and ICCR scholarships. Working together in important areas like water supply, agriculture, health and education, we have tried to bring positive changes in the lives of the people of Tanzania”

Poll dates for all 5 states announced. Check details here

Mizoram: November 7

Chhattisgarh: 1st Phase: November 7, 2nd Phase: November 17

Madhya Pradesh: November 17

Rajasthan: November 23

Telangana: November 30

To inspire young voters, over 2,900 polling stations will be managed by youth: Chief Election Commissioner Rajiv Kumar

There will be 1.77 lakh polling stations; 1.1 lakh stations to have web-casting facilities: CEC

In 40 days visited all 5 States and held discussions with political parties, Central and State enforcement agencies: CEC

Total voters in Mizoram are 8.52 lakh, 2.03 crore in Chhattisgarh, 5.6 cr in Madhya Pradesh, 5.25 crore in Rajasthan and 3.17 crore in Telangana: Chief Election Commissioner Rajiv Kumar

Total number of voters in 5 poll-bound states is 16.1 crore: CEC Rajiv Kumar
